Public concern is mounting in Kanniyakumari district over the alarming rise in underage riders, many of whom engage in rash driving, with several incidents ending in tragedy.

According to an official statement from the Kanniyakumari District Police, six individuals have lost their lives in road accidents that happened in the past two months with some being underage riders, while others were college students.

Abilash, a truck driver from Kottar, says there has been a sharp increase in school students riding two wheelers during holidays. “Most of these children ride without helmets and indulge in dangerous stunts. Even in heavily congested areas like Kottar, they perform risky manoeuvres simply to attract attention,” he said.

He added that the situation is far worse in the outskirts and peri-urban areas, where there is little to no regulation or monitoring. “The careless behavior not only puts their own lives at risk but also endangers motorists who follow traffic rules,” he cautioned.
